Cognac is simply a special type of brandy distilled in the Cognac region. Any brandy that is distilled outside this region cannot be called so under any circumstances. Brandy is a form of alcohol that is very famous all around the world. It is a special breed of French wine wherein the water is removed from the wine once it has been fermented, thus making it stronger and more concentrated in nature. The origins of brandy can be traced back to the 16th century when wine was traded between Holland and France and transported via war vessels. Some captains, with the aim to save space and cut costs, used to remove the water from the wine during transportation and then used to replace the water when the wine reached the destination. Pretty soon people started liking the wine without the water being put back in, and this came to be known as brandy. The name stems from the term Brandewijn which means burnt wine. Cognac is a very elitist and royal drink that has so much interesting information about it, and this is something that every alcohol lover should know. Here are some facts about it that will help you learn more.
  • It is only distilled in the Cognac region of France.
  • The brandy is only distilled from certain types of grapes, the most famous of which is Ugni Blanc.
  • It is distilled twice in copper pot stills, and must be aged for at least 2 years in Limousin Oak barrels.
  • The different grades available are VS (Very Superior), VSOP (Very Superior Old Pale) and XO (Extra Old).
  • The United States is the single biggest market for Cognac in the world, especially since the hip-hop industry embraced it as its drink of choice.
  • Many people believe that Remy Martin, Henessy, Martell, and Courvoisier are the best brands, since their sales constitute 90% of sales all over the world.
